Job Description

POSITION:    Peer Navigator
OFFICE:        Mayor's Office on Returning Citizen Affairs (MORCA)
OPEN:            November 21, 2025
CLOSED:       December 5, 2025
GRADE:        Excepted Service, Grade 4 (ES-4)
SALARY:      $62,751.00

This is an Excepted Service position. Selected candidate must be a District resident or establish residency within 180 days of hire.

Current District of Columbia residents will receive priority and advanced preference for screening and interviews.

 

background

The Mayor's Office on Returning Citizen Affairs (MORCA) provides useful information for the empowerment of previously incarcerated persons in order to create a productive and supportive environment where persons may thrive, prosper, and contribute to the social, political, and economic development of self, family, and community. MORCA's mission is to provide zealous advocacy, high-quality services and products, and up-to-date information for the empowerment of previously incarcerated persons. For more information on the office, please visit here: 

In order to be successful in this role, you will need to have prior experience in both program management, coordinate efforts across departments and knowledgeable of DC reentry and returning Citizens resources.

 

Major duties

  • Help returning citizens navigate local supportive care systems, using personal and professional experiences.
  • Strengthen partnerships between the District’s returning citizen community, the Mayor’s Office on Returning Citizen's Affairs (MORCA), and organizations serving the returning citizen community.
  • Identify areas of need in the District's returning citizen community and work with the Director to establish and maintain strategic relationships with community organizations.
  • Organize and facilitate returning citizen stakeholder meetings with members of the community, Service Organizations, District agencies, and Federal agencies.
  • Coordinates services among District agencies to ensure timely responses to community concerns.
  • Works together with other Community Affairs Agencies in the development of community engagement strategies.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.
 

COMPETENCIES, K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S, AND ABILITIES

  • Knowledge of the mission, goals, objectives, policies, procedures, and regulations of MORCA.
  • Knowledge of the program services provided through MORCA and other partnering agencies.
  • Able to work well under pressure and meet tough deadlines in a fast paced, demanding environment.
  • Constituent focused; positive outlook; strong people skills.
  • Experience with core issues facing the returning citizen community.
  • Knowledge of and skill in the application of analytical and evaluative theories, concepts, procedures, methods, standards and practices to the interpretation of policy, and to meet existing and future service requirements. 
  • Ability to organize and manage projects; to review, analyze, and evaluate data; and to prepare analytical reports.

 

Minimum  qualifications

  • Must be a returning citizen who's successfully navigated District programs designed to engage and reintegrated. 
  • Direct personal or professional experience with the District of Columbia's returning citizens community.
  • Demonstrated experience engaging with the returning citizen community with a focus of connecting people to available services and benefits.
 

Work environment

The work is performed primarily in-person. Times in the field are frequently required for related events.

 

SPECIAL NOTE - SECURITY SENSITIVE

This position is deemed security sensitive. The incumbent of this position will be subject to enhanced suitability screening pursuant to Chapter 4 of DC Personnel Regulations, Suitability – Security Sensitive.

 

RESIDENCY REQUIREMENT

There is a legal requirement that each new appointee to the Excepted Service either:
  1. be a District of Columbia resident at the time of appointment; or
  2. become a District resident within one hundred eighty (180) days of appointment.

The law also requires that Excepted Service employees remain District residents during the duration of the individual’s appointment. Failure to remain a District resident for the duration of the appointment will result in forfeiture of employment.
